Ingredients

  • 2 teaspoons dried rosemary, crushed
  • 4 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 teaspoon pepper
  • 1 (5 pound) bone-in pork loin roast
  • 1 (11 ounce) can mandarin oranges, drained
  • ½ cup orange marmalade
  • 6 tablespoons orange juice concentrate
  • ¼ cup soy sauce
  • ¼ cup ketchup
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 2 ¼ teaspoons ground mustard
  • 1 ½ teaspoons ground ginger
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ced

Information

  • Prep Time: 20 mins
  • Cook Time: 1 hr 45 mins
  • Total Time: 2 hrs 5 mins
  • Servings: 10
  • Yield: 10 servings

  • Combine rosemary, garlic and pepper; rub over roast. Place roast, fat side up, on a rack in a shallow roasting pan. Bake, uncovered, at 350 degrees F for 1-1/4 to 1-1/2 hours. Arrange oranges over roast. Combine glaze ingredients; brush over roast. Bake 30 minutes longer or until a meat thermometer reads 145 degrees (63 degrees C), brushing often with glaze. Let stand 10 minutes before slicing.
